Kafka不会完全取代负载均衡器。Kafka是一个分布式流处理平台,主要用于高吞吐量、低延迟的数据传输和处理。而负载均衡器是一种用于在多个服务器之间分配负载的设备或软件。
虽然Kafka可以实现消息的发布和订阅,但它并不具备负载均衡器的所有功能。负载均衡器可以根据服务器的负载情况,动态地将请求分发到不同的服务器上,以实现负载均衡和高可用性。而Kafka主要用于分布式数据流处理,将数据进行分区和复制,以实现高吞吐量和数据冗余。
在实际应用中,可以将Kafka与负载均衡器结合使用,以实现更好的性能和可靠性。负载均衡器可以将请求分发到多个Kafka集群中的不同节点上,以实现负载均衡和高可用性。同时,负载均衡器还可以监控Kafka集群的状态,并根据需要进行动态调整。
对于Kafka的应用场景,它适用于大规模的实时数据处理和流式计算场景,例如日志收集、事件驱动架构、实时分析等。对于这些场景,可以使用腾讯云的消息队列 CKafka,它是基于开源的Apache Kafka构建的分布式消息队列服务。CKafka提供高可用性、高吞吐量、低延迟的消息传输和处理能力,适用于各种大规模数据处理场景。
更多关于腾讯云CKafka的信息,请参考:CKafka产品介绍
领取专属 10元无门槛券
手把手带您无忧上云